How to Wear Psychedelic Prints Without Looking Like a 90s Rave Flashback

Psychedelic prints are having a moment again. But if you lived through the 90s—or even just seen the photos—you know that wearing them wrong can land you squarely in costume territory. The trick isn’t to avoid the prints, but to ground them in real clothes that feel like yours. Here’s how to do it without the rave flashback. Start small. For more commitment, go for a top or bottom in the print, and keep the rest of the outfit simple. The MEALLDAY Melt Tee ($130.00, PRE-ORDER) pairs naturally with olive cargo pants or dark wash jeans. The key is contrast: let the print do the work, and everything else becomes a supporting player. No neon accessories, no tie-dye hats. Just one piece, done well. Layering helps, too. Psychedelic prints look best when the clothes fit well—not baggy like a rave hand-me-down. Crisp lines and modern cuts keep things fresh.
